As if O.J. Simpson doesn't have enough problems, the former football star was "dishonored" Sunday with a Golden Razzie award for one of the worst film performances of 1994.

In the Golden Raspberry Foundation's annual spoof of the Academy Awards, Simpson - who is on trial on double-murder charges - was named worst supporting actor for his role in the comedy "Naked Gun 331/3."It was described as a "criminally unconvincing" performance by "the most hyped murder suspect since Cain."

John Wilson, a Hollywood publicist who organizes the Razzies each year, admitted that the foundation may be accused of picking on Simpson.

"This is not about making anything more miserable in his life than it already is," Wilson said. "But the simple fact is the guy can't act."

Topping this year's Razzies, Kevin Costner won worst actor for his title role in "Wyatt Earp."

Sharon Stone was named worst actress for "Intersection" and "The Specialist." The award for worst picture went to "Color of Night."
